
Whitecaps FC Loan Myer Bevan to Swedish Club Husqvarna FF
March 28, 2018 - Major League Soccer (MLS)
Vancouver Whitecaps FC News Release
VANCOUVER, BC - Vancouver WhitecapsFC announced on Wednesday that the club has loaned striker Myer Bevan to Swedish club Husqvarna FF through July 10, with options to recall, and to extend through the end of 2018.
Competing in the Division 1 Södra, the third tier of football in Sweden, Husqvarna FF begin league play on April 8.
"This is a great opportunity for Myer to pick up some important minutes on the pitch," said Whitecaps FC head coach Carl Robinson. "He's shown that hunger you're looking for at training, and putting him in this environment will further push him in his development. We're looking forward to following his progress."
The 20-year old New Zealand international signed a first-team contract with the 'Caps last December after emerging last year with Whitecaps FC 2. He finished the 2017 USL campaign with three goals in 11 starts and 13 appearances after signing midway through the season.
The Auckland native was recently called up to the New Zealand men's national team, earning his third cap as a substitute in their March 24 friendly against Canada. He made his senior debut for the Kiwis last year, scoring his first goal in just his second appearance in FIFA World Cup qualifying against Solomon Islands.
TRANSACTION: Vancouver Whitecaps FC loan Myer Bevan to Swedish Division 1 Södra side Husqvarna FF through July 10, with options to recall, and to extend through the end of 2018, on Wednesday, March 28, 2018.
